Transaction 6566f472b4c09c7561d0035b7471596b27f80fc816142d51a1f7addb56fe24ae
2 Input
2 Outputs
- 6566f472b4c09c7561d0035b7471596b27f80fc816142d51a1f7addb56fe24ae:0
- 6566f472b4c09c7561d0035b7471596b27f80fc816142d51a1f7addb56fe24ae:1
value 7890242
address 3FF1uZ5oEaSZYKCvGbywu39djsknrGeu96
value 1359994
address 1JFtcENWmihvw2j3HWFkBqw9of2WobWNHJ